Who is Leonard Ellerbe? A Quick Look
Leonard Ellerbe is a widely recognized and, you know, quite influential figure in the professional boxing world. He's best known for his role as the CEO of Mayweather Promotions, the boxing promotional company founded by the legendary undefeated boxer, Floyd Mayweather Jr. Their relationship goes back many years, stretching from their amateur days, which really speaks to a deep, personal connection.
Ellerbe has been a trusted advisor, a close friend, and a key business partner to Mayweather throughout his career. He's often seen by Mayweather's side, whether at press conferences, during training camps, or in the corner during fights. This long-standing partnership has, in some respects, been a cornerstone of Mayweather's incredible success, both inside and outside the ring.

Mayweather Promotions: A Key Pillar of Wealth
Mayweather Promotions stands as the primary engine behind much of Leonard Ellerbe's professional wealth and influence. As CEO, he's been instrumental in shaping the company's direction and executing its vision. This isn't just about putting on fights; it's about building a brand, managing talent, and, you know, really maximizing revenue from every possible angle. The company has been responsible for promoting some of the biggest pay-per-view events in boxing history, generating hundreds of millions of dollars.
His responsibilities at Mayweather Promotions are, you know, quite extensive. They include overseeing fight negotiations, managing fighter contracts, securing lucrative endorsement deals, and handling the overall business operations. It's a role that demands sharp negotiation skills, a deep understanding of the boxing landscape, and a keen eye for business opportunities. Ellerbe has, arguably, demonstrated all of these qualities consistently over the years.
The success of Mayweather Promotions is, in a way, a direct reflection of Ellerbe's strategic input. He helped orchestrate the business side of fights that broke pay-per-view records, like the highly anticipated bouts against Manny Pacquiao and Conor McGregor. These events weren't just sporting spectacles; they were massive financial undertakings, and Ellerbe was right there, managing the intricate details to ensure their commercial success. His involvement in these colossal events undoubtedly contributes significantly to his own financial standing, as, you know, executives in such positions often receive substantial compensation and bonuses tied to company performance.
